为什么使用http状态代码与整数来处理http错误



过去有人告诉我,在评估http响应时,我应该使用实际的状态代码,而不是硬键入整数。有什么原因吗?我唯一能想到的原因是状态代码是一个常量。

示例:

if resp.StatusCode != http.StatusOK {

if resp.StatusCode != 200 {

它最注重可读性。对于一些不太常见的代码,最好有可读的东西,而不是让别人查找。

最新更新